Before the Checklist: Confirm the Work Environment
"Safety toe" covers a lot of ground. If your team works in light manufacturing, assembly, or a warehouse, Red Wing work safety toe shoes in medium duty are usually the right call. They handle standing on concrete, light debris, and occasional impacts. But if anyone's routinely around forklifts or heavy loads, you could be looking at a heavy duty spec, or even metatarsal guards on top of the toe rating.
People assume the job title tells you what you need. What they don't see is the actual floor conditions. I ordered "standard warehouse" shoes for a crew once, and one guy was walking on expanded metal grates over a paint line every day. He went through two pairs of soles in a year. The shoe wasn't wrong—the environment was just rougher than the job description suggested.
Step 1: Measure Feet Properly—Including Width
Here's the thing that took me the longest to understand: Red Wing work safety toe shoes width options matter as much as length. A guy who's worn 10.5 sneakers his whole life might actually need a 10.5 EE in a safety toe. Why? Because safety toes are built differently. The toe cap adds volume, and the boot's last is wider than an athletic shoe's. If you just go by sneaker size, you'll order boots that pinch, rub, and get "forgotten" at home.
Don't trust self-reported sizes. Have a fitting session. I didn't do this on my first big order—went off a spreadsheet that HR had put together—and about a third of the boots had to go back. Exchange logistics, two weeks of scrambling to get people proper footwear... actually, do you know how many safety violations you can accumulate in two weeks with people wearing unacceptable footwear? I found out. It's more than you'd think.
If you're measuring a group, here's the practical version:
- Measure both feet. Most people have one foot bigger than the other, and the boots need to fit the larger one.
- Measure at the end of the day. Feet swell. Morning sizes are small sizes.
- Have someone who knows how to use a Brannock device do it, or find a store that does. Red Wing stores are genuinely good at this—it's their fitting expertise.
Step 2: Verify the ASTM Rating, Not the Marketing
"Medium duty" is a useful way to narrow your search, but it's not an official rating. The actual standard that matters is ASTM F2413, which covers impact and compression resistance for safety toe footwear. If the shoe doesn't carry that mark, it is not a certified safety shoe.
Why does this matter to you as the buyer? Because the liability lands on the employer, not the brand. Per OSHA (osha.gov), employers are responsible for ensuring PPE meets the applicable consensus standards. I've had an auditor walk through and check the sole markings on every shoe in the locker room. He wasn't being dramatic. He was doing his job, and my paperwork had to back it up.
One more thing: ASTM ratings aren't all the same. Some Red Wing models carry electrical hazard (EH) protection. Some have a static dissipative (SD) rating. Others are just impact and compression. Read the spec sheet for the specific product you're ordering, and compare it against any contract requirements your site has. Don't assume "safety toe" covers everything.
Step 3: Order the Width Mix You Actually Need
This ties directly into Step 1, but I'm making it its own step because it's the single most common error I see in PPE purchasing. Red Wing work safety toe shoes come in a range of widths—D-width is standard, but you'll likely need C, EE, or EEE for a decent chunk of your crew.
It took me about two years and roughly 40 shoe orders to finally see the pattern: width isn't a special case you handle when someone complains. It's a core part of the order. On a crew of 20, you'll almost always have 5-7 people who need a non-D width. If you don't ask for it in the initial quote, it becomes a change order later—more admin time, more shipping, and an annoyed safety manager.
The checklist for this step:
- Tally the widths you need. Count, don't guess.
- Ask the vendor if the model you're ordering comes in your needed widths. Not all styles are available in all widths.
- Order a small buffer (one or two extra pairs) of the most common sizes. You'll thank yourself when the new hire starts mid-cycle. (I really should do this more often instead of scrambling for individual pairs.)
Step 4: Bundle the Eye and Hearing Protection in the Same Order
Footwear is the expensive line item, but your PPE program isn't done until you've covered eyes and ears. It saves time, shipping, and processing cost to bundle these if your vendor carries them. And if your vendor doesn't carry them, find someone who does.
Safety Glasses: Look for the Z87 Mark
The Nemesis safety glasses are a solid choice—a wrap-style frame that fits most face shapes and passes the "will my crew actually wear these" test. But whatever you order, it should be marked ANSI Z87.1 or Z87+. A lens without that marking is not PPE. It doesn't matter how sturdy the frame feels. Without the mark, it's a pair of glasses.
I check this on every order now, mostly because I made the mistake once. A supplier offered a "tactical style" glass that looked impressive on the shelf. No Z87 marking anywhere. My safety coordinator caught it before distribution and we had to re-order. That was the moment I learned: the mark isn't a detail. It's the whole point.
Hearing Protection: Start With the Noise Level, Not the Product
"How do earplugs work?" is the wrong question to start with. Earplugs create a physical seal in the ear canal that reduces the sound energy reaching the eardrum. That part is simple. The practical question is: what noise exposure does your crew actually have, and what noise reduction rating (NRR) do they need?
If the work area is above 85 dB on a consistent basis, you need earplugs with a real NRR—typically 32 or 33 for foam plugs. If the noise is intermittent, or if workers need to communicate, banded plugs or earmuffs give them the option to pull the protection away when they need to hear speech or machine cues.
What most people don't realize is that the terms "earplug" and "hearing protection" are not synonyms. I handed out a box of cheap pre-molded plugs to a crew working next to a punch press. They were technically earplugs, rated at something like 22 NRR. The foreman pulled me aside and told me they might as well be wearing nothing. He was right. Foam plugs at 32-33 NRR would have been the baseline for that area.

Step 6: Confirm Warranty and Exchange Before You Commit
Here's something vendors won't tell you: warranty duration varies by model, and the clock often starts at the invoice date, not when your employees actually get the boots. I lost a warranty claim on a pair that failed at month 13 because the boots sat in my office for three weeks after delivery. Nothing malicious—I just didn't read the policy carefully enough.
Before you place a bulk order, ask:
- How long is the warranty on this specific model?
- What's the exchange process for sizing issues?
- Are width exchanges treated differently from length exchanges?
- Who handles warranty claims—the vendor or the manufacturer?
- What documentation do we need to keep? (Receipts, order numbers, photos of the defect.)
These questions take five minutes. The answers can save you hundreds of dollars and a lot of awkward conversations with employees whose gear failed.
Common Mistakes to Avoid
- All D-widths. A crew of 20 will almost always have 5-7 people who need EE or wider. Order the mix.
- Skipping the ASTM check. If it doesn't say ASTM F2413 on the shoe, it's not certified safety footwear. Full stop.
- Ignoring the NRR number. Earplugs work, but only up to their rating. Match the rating to the actual noise level.
- Buying eye protection without the Z87 mark. It's a five-second check. Don't skip it.
- Believing self-reported shoe sizes. People inaccurately estimate their own shoe size constantly. Measure them.
- Not checking the warranty clock. Delivery time counts. If boots sit in a stockroom for three weeks, that's three weeks of warranty gone.
